Mrs. Irene Fuller Williams, affectionately known as “Fats”, departed this life on May 23, 2015 in Des Moines, Iowa. She was 80 years old. She was born to Lucille and Relus Fuller May 12, 1935 in Shreveport, Louisiana. Both parents, three brothers, Joseph Fuller, M.C. Fuller, and J.C. Fuller, her beloved husband, Mack Williams, Jr., and her grandson, John Ray Fuller precede her in death.

Irene accepted Christ in the early part of her life at White Roall Baptist Church in Shongaloo, Louisiana. Irene worked for Holiday Inn for 15 years. She went to Hope, Arkansas to make a home as a single parent. She worked for Tyson for about 10 years, then moved to Des Moines, Iowa and worked for Holiday Inn for an additional 16 years and for Hotel Fort Des Moines, from where she retired.

Irene loved fishing, football, old cowboy movies, Steven Segal, dancing, cooking, and spending time with her children, grandchildren, and great-grandchildren and her favorite pet dog, Emma. She was loved by all and will be missed by everybody.

Irene leaves to cherish her memory: son, Raymond Fuller, Jr. (Brenda Dixon), daughters, Willamenia Jordan (Otha Jordan) and Shirley Fuller (Norven Logan), sisters, Mildred Manning of Cullin, LA, Wilora White of San Diego, CA, and Estes White of Indianapolis, IN, and brothers, Albert White of Cullin, LA, and Andrew White and Willie White of Indianapolis, IN. Irene had 22 grandchildren, 44 great-grandchildren, 8 great-great-grandchildren, and a host of nieces, nephews, cousins and friends.

Irene was united in marriage to her beloved husband, Mack Williams on August 30, 1989. He went to heaven on December 25, 2010. They were inseparable and enjoyed fishing and traveling together.
